Spinal Cord Detethering may help relieve the abnormal stretching of the spinal cord caused by tethering to nearby tissues. Depending on the underlying cause, the surgeon may release a tight filum terminale, separate scar tissue, or address other structures restricting spinal cord movement. The goal is to reduce ongoing neurological stress and, when possible, prevent progression of symptoms. Postoperative monitoring focuses on neurological function, wound healing, and bladder or bowel symptoms when affected.
